Name : spectrum Product : Fedora 14 Version : 1.4.7 Release : 1.fc14 URL : http://spectrum.im/ Summary : XMPP transport/gateway Description : Spectrum is an XMPP transport/gateway. It allows XMPP users to communicate with their friends who are using one of the supported networks. Spectrum is written in C++ and uses the Gloox XMPP library and libpurple for “legacy networks”. Spectrum supports a wide range of different networks such as ICQ, XMPP (Jabber, GTalk), AIM, MSN, Facebook, Twitter, Gadu-Gadu, IRC and SIMPLE.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Update Information: Upstream update * General: - Fixed various bugs and crashes. - Resize and convert avatars before sending them into legacy network. - Working nicknames/groups synchronization in both directions using Remote Roster protoXEP. Upgrade to the latest upstream: * Map Extended Away status to Away if particular libpurple protocol plugin does not support XA status. * Added new filetransfer_force_cache_storage=0 config variable to force storing files from legacy network on server. This is also configurable per user via Transport Settings adhoc commands. * Added "Reject all incoming authorizations" Transport Settings option. * Fixed forwarding of initial presence to XMPP user when more resource are connected. * ICQ: working XStatus forwarding from ICQ buddies to XMPP user (not for EPEL-5). * XMPP: Fixed GTalk's new email notification when there are more pending emails. * IRC: Fixed forwarding of IRC users modes changes. * Yahoo: Fixed issues when receiving messages from MSN buddies using Yahoo transport.
